Story

So why the London Marathon? This is a question I've asked myself many times over the past few weeks. Early morning runs in freezing conditions, monsoon rains, sleet, snow, mud ice and flooded paths have tested my resolve. I've managed to keep going and managed to include more exotic locations to run, during trips abroad. This included the run in the desert in Al Ain (30 degree heat, a dried up river bed and a large herd of goats was a change from Richmond Park) and circuits of the Charles river basin in Boston (where Spring has arrived). Over 600 miles and I'm nearly there and no injuries  (unless you count my toenails).

This will be one of the greatest physical challenges I have encountered and I'm now really looking forward to it. I'm running for GOSH Charity as they do so much to support the work that we do and I just wanted to say 'thanks' in a tangible way. The benefits of this is that they give you a distinctive running vest (hopefully it will be warmer by race day), a much needed massage at the end and there's no chance I'll need to don a banana costume!

I am so grateful for your support to help me get across the line, its all the motivation I need!

About the charity

We fundraise to enhance Great Ormond Street Hospital’s ability to transform the health and wellbeing of children and young people. Donations help to fund advanced medical equipment, child and family support services, pioneering research and rebuilding and refurbishment.
